MAOS of D‐Gluconic Acid, D‐Glucono‐1,4‐ and 1,5‐Lactones, Esters, Hydrazides, and Benzimidazoles ThereofFootnote

Microwave‐assisted organic synthesis (MAOS) of D‐gluconic acid can be efficiently done by oxidation of D‐glucose with bromine water, upon irradiation with microwave (MW). It was also used for the conversion of D‐gluconic acid to ethyl D‐gluconate, D‐glucono‐1,4‐ and 1,5‐lactones, gluconyl hydrazide, and gluconyl phenylhydrazide in yields comparable to those obtained by conventional methods, but in much shorter times. A convenient microwave‐mediated condensation of D‐gluconic acid with o‐phenylenediamines provided the respective acyclonucleoside benzimidazole in short time and good yield.
